thecalcs's answer
Thecalcs began as a personal experiment by Souhayb Kamal, a full-stack developer, to make technical calculators more usable and beautiful. After realizing that most online calculators were outdated, inaccurate, or overloaded with ads, he started building modern, responsive, and precise tools powered by clean code and real-world formulas. What started with a few math and finance tools grew into a full SaaS-style calculator library — now trusted by thousands of users and used by companies worldwide to develop custom tools for their own websites.

thecalcs's answer
Frontend: Next.js, React, Tailwind CSS, TypeScript
Data & SEO: JSON Schema for formulas, custom metadata indexing
Infrastructure: Vercel for deployment and performance
Analytics & Automation: Google Search Console, IndexNow, Ahrefs integration
